• Блог
  • Monthly roundup - January 2018: Inkscape DPI, version awareness, Bail, and Carlita

Щомісячний огляд - січень 2018: Inkscape DPI, обізнаність про версії, Bail та Carlita

6 роки, 7 місяці назад.
By ???

Це ваш щомісячний огляд новин фрітрекінгу за останні чотири тижні, а також погляд на те, що чекає на нас у наступному місяці.

Озираючись на січень

Скоріше цього місяця

Можливо, це рекордно депресивна погода в моїй місцевості , , але я відчуваю, що січень дуже сильно мене виснажив. Тож давайте подивимося, чи є у нас хоч щось , що ми можемо показати.

Проблема з одиницями виміру за замовчуванням у Inkscape

На початку року ми випустили core v1.3.0 для вирішення проблеми #204 , також відомої як проблема з одиницями виміру Inkscape за замовчуванням.

Це було дещо незвичне виправлення, тому що ми були змушені зробити це через зміни, внесені розробниками Inkscape. Крім того, нам довелося не лише адаптувати наш код, але й перенести зміни на в усі ваші існуючі чернетки.

Якщо ви щасливо не знали про це, ми написали про це статтю в блозі: Вийшло ядро Freesewing v1.3.0; Виправлення настільки хороші, що ми перенесли їх у всі ваші чернетки.

Поінформованість про версії

Тепер ми відстежуємо, яка версія ядра згенерувала вашу чернетку. Ми постійно випускаємо виправлення та покращення . Тому чернетки, які ви зберігаєте у своєму профілі, можуть бути застарілими.

Тепер ви будете проінформовані про це як на самій сторінці проекту, так і у вашому списку проектів. Просте редагування оновить їх до останньої версії.

Довгострокове бачення версійності

Це рішення є кроком вперед у порівнянні з попередньою ситуацією, але воно не дозволяє здійснювати дуже гранульований контроль версій. Якщо у вашому профілі зберігається 10 різних чернеток Simon, а ми змінили номер основної версії через те, що внесли зміни до Carlton, всі ваші чернетки будуть позначені як застарілі, навіть якщо ці зміни на них не вплинули.

Маючи лише один номер версії ядра, ми не маємо очевидного способу відстежувати , які зміни впливають на який шаблон.

Довгостроковий план полягає в тому, щоб мати номер основної версії та номер версії шаблону. Таким чином, зміна версії в одному шаблоні не вплине на інші шаблони.

Зміна версії в ядрі все одно вплине на всі шаблони, але версій ядра має бути набагато менше після того, як ми вилучимо всі шаблони з ядра.

Ідея полягає в тому, що кожен шаблон буде у власному репозиторії, і ми будемо використовувати composer, щоб керувати ними як залежностями.

Але це довгострокова ідея, яка не буде реалізована, поки ми не перепишемо ядро. Так, це ще одна довгострокова ідея.

Застава за обробку помилок

У першій половині місяця ми спробували Rollbar для обробки помилок і звітів. Хоча нам подобалася його функціональність, ми були не надто задоволені можливим впливом на вашу конфіденційність на сайті у зв’язку з надсиланням таких даних третій стороні.

Тож ми вирішили написати власний ролбар для бідняків під назвою Bail. Bail тепер використовується в наших даних та основних бекендах, тому, коли щось ламається, ми знаємо про це.

Ці зусилля також призвели до 2-тижневого паралельного квесту з написання тестів для нашого бекенду даних. Всі деталі: Представляємо фрісевінг заставу: Ролбар для бідняка --- тому що приватність

Карліта тут.

Кілька днів тому ми випустили пальто Карліта, жіночу версію нашого пальта Карлтон.

Якщо ви поспішили отримати Карліту, то знайте, що вона була випущена як частина ядра v1.6.0, а зараз ми працюємо над версією v1.6.3, і це в основному завдяки виправленням та налаштуванням у Carlton/Carlita.

Якщо у вас є більш рання версія шаблону, будь ласка, переробіть його. Якщо ви вже роздрукували , то, можливо, подивіться журнал змін , щоб зрозуміти, що змінилося.

Якщо ви перевірите журнал змін, то побачите, що ми почали місяць на ядрі v1.2.9, а зараз працює на ядрі v1.6.3, так що я не думаю, що це просто ідея, що це був напружений місяць.

Забігаючи наперед на лютий

Лютий - короткий місяць, тому, мабуть, найкраще керувати очікуваннями. Але ось що я маю на увазі:

Документація Carlton/Carlita

Чесно кажучи, для мене це все одно, що виривати зуби, тому не сподівайтеся, що я закінчу до кінця лютого, але я мав би принаймні трохи просунутися з документацією для візерунків Карлтон і Карліта.

До речі, зростаюча популярність цього сайту означає, що я набагато більше займаюся різними питаннями і дрібними проблемами, які потребують моєї уваги.

Всі ці відгуки - це добре , адже саме завдяки їм ми покращуємо нашу роботу. Але я помічаю, що стає дедалі важче присвячувати більший проміжок часу одній конкретній справі. Це саме те, що вам потрібно для вирішення більших завдань, таких як написання документації або розробка нових патернів.

У мене немає рішення для цього, я просто роблю спостереження.

Можливо, реліз Блейка Блейзера

У мене на креслярській дошці лежить викрійка піджака, яка висіла там ще з літа (вона називається “Блейзер Блейк”). Я дійсно повинен знайти трохи часу, щоб завершити його і опублікувати, але я неохоче це роблю, тому що я не можу знайти час, щоб дійсно зробити піджак.

Я вже використовувала цю викрійку для моїх рефайндерів цього року, , але це не зовсім дуже репрезентативний приклад.

Не думаю, що в лютому я знайду час пошити піджак, але, можливо, мусліну буде достатньо , щоб опублікувати його в бета-версії.

FOSDEM

Всі деталі на fosdem.org

FOSDEM --- Європейська зустріч розробників вільного та відкритого програмного забезпечення --- відбудеться у перші вихідні лютого в Брюсселі.

Я планую бути там у неділю, тож якщо ви теж будете там, дайте мені знати або приходьте привітатися.

Claim this post

This post has not (yet) been associated with a FreeSewing account. Please help us assign proper credit: